Artificial fish nest for natural water area
Technical Field
The utility model belongs to the technical field related to fishery, and particularly relates to an artificial fish nest for a natural water area.
Background
The spawning sites and habitats of the freshwater fishes are seriously damaged under the interference of natural and human factors, and fishery resources are increasingly declined. In recent years, artificial fish nests are widely applied to the repair and management of fresh water watershed and estuary fishery resources and habitat thereof, an effective way is provided for protecting the biodiversity of the fresh water watershed and making fishery management measures and the like, and the following defects exist in the existing production process:
when an existing aquaculture worker manufactures artificial fish nests, aquatic plants are still bound on the whole fishing net, the plurality of connected fish nests are mainly manufactured, when the artificial fish nests are used, the whole fish nests are sunk to the water bottom for fish spawning and breeding, however, the fish nests which are bound by the aquatic plants and connected together by the artificial fish nests are not detachable when the artificial fish nests are used, and time and labor are wasted; when the breeding personnel want to take out the fish nests and check the breeding condition, all the fish nests can be taken out, the operation is complex, and time and labor are wasted.

Examples
Referring to fig. 1-3, the present invention provides the following technical solutions: an artificial fish nest for a natural water area comprises an upper floating plate 1, a flat plate 2 and a plurality of fish nest inserting frames 3, wherein the flat plate 2 is fixed at the upper ends of two sides of the upper floating plate 1 respectively, the upper ends of the surfaces of the flat plate 2 are provided with a plurality of slots 201 respectively, each fish nest inserting frame 3 consists of a strip-shaped flat plate 301, a float grass hanging net 303 and two L-shaped frames 302, the L-shaped frames 302 are oppositely arranged to form a vertical rectangular frame, the float grass hanging net 303 is arranged in the rectangular frame formed by the two L-shaped frames 302, the float grass hanging net 303 consists of a plurality of transverse and vertical interlaced elastic ropes 304, the end parts of the elastic ropes 304 are fixedly connected with the corresponding L-shaped frames 302, the strip-shaped flat plate 301 is fixed on the upper surface of the L-shaped frames 302, the fish nest inserting frames 3 are respectively inserted and inserted in the corresponding slots 201, the strip-shaped flat plates 301 are tightly clamped with the corresponding slots 201, and the fish nest inserting frames 3 adopt rectangular frames, the pasture and water hanging net 303 consisting of two groups of elastic ropes is arranged in the two L-shaped frames 302, meshes of the pasture and water hanging net 303 can be enlarged when the two L-shaped frames 302 are pulled oppositely, and a bunch of pasture and water can be clamped by being contracted when the two L-shaped frames 302 are placed in holes of the tiled pasture and water hanging net 303, so that the pasture and water hanging net is simple and convenient.
In the embodiment of the utility model, the artificial fish nest comprises a water floating plate 1, a flat plate 2 and a plurality of fish nest inserting frames 3, a plurality of artificial fish nest monomers 7 are mutually connected and arranged on the water surface, prepared aquatic plants are paved on the shore, the plurality of fish nest inserting frames 3 are respectively taken down and two L-shaped frames 302 are pulled one by one in opposite directions to expand meshes of an aquatic plant hanging net 303, then the aquatic plant hanging net 303 is attached to the paved aquatic plants one by one and tightened, partial aquatic plants can be clamped in the meshes of the aquatic plant hanging net 303, then the plurality of fish nest inserting frames 3 are respectively inserted into slots 201 of the flat plate 2 to be clamped, cultured fishes can lay fish eggs on the aquatic plants on the aquatic plant hanging net 303 when the fish eggs need to be taken out, the fish nest inserting frames 3 are pulled out, the water floating plate 1 of the plurality of artificial fish nest monomers 7 can be paved into a passageway matrix 8 for people to walk, and a floater 6 is arranged at one end, the artificial fish nest is kept to float and stand in the water body, the inverted shape, winding or deformation is avoided, more microorganisms or impurities can be adsorbed, the propagation of fish can be promoted, the water body can be purified, and the water body environment can be beautified.
Specifically, referring to fig. 1 and 2, a plurality of hooks 4 and a plurality of hanging rings 5 are respectively fixed on the front side and the rear side of the artificial fish nest single body 7, and the hooks 4 and the hanging rings 5 are arranged to be hooked with each other on the artificial fish nest single body 7.
In this embodiment: a plurality of hooks 4 and a plurality of hanging rings 5 are fixed on the front side and the rear side of the artificial fish nest single body 7 respectively, the plurality of artificial fish nest single bodies 7 are hung and arranged on the water surface through the plurality of hooks 4 and the plurality of hanging rings 5, prepared aquatic weeds are paved on the bank, and the plurality of hooks 4 and the plurality of hanging rings 5 through which the artificial fish nest single bodies 7 pass are hung and arranged on the water surface.
Specifically, referring to fig. 1, the flat plates 2 are rectangular plates, and the slots 201 are perpendicular to the long side walls of the corresponding flat plates 2 and are arranged at equal intervals.
In this embodiment: dull and stereotyped 2 is the rectangular plate, and the equal perpendicular to of slot 201 of the dull and stereotyped 2's that corresponds long lateral wall and equidistant setting are inserted respectively back to dull and stereotyped 2's slot 201 interior card can through setting up a plurality of fish nest grafting frames 3 of slot 201.
Specifically, referring to fig. 1, the two sides of the upper end of the water floating plate 1 are provided with the adhesion substrates 8, and the adhesion substrates 8 are fixed on the unit box 10 through the retaining ring 9.
In this embodiment: the two sides of the upper end of the water floating plate 1 are provided with the adhesion substrates 8, the adhesion substrates 8 are fixed on the unit box body 10 through the retaining rings 9, and the retaining rings 9 are made of stainless steel, so that the adhesion substrates 8 are convenient to detach and can be periodically checked and replaced.
Specifically, referring to fig. 1, a float 6 is disposed at one end of an adhesion matrix 8, and the adhesion matrix 8 is a superfine fiber artificial float grass.
In this embodiment: one end of the adhesive matrix 8 is provided with a floater 6 to keep the artificial fish nest floating and upright in the water body, avoid inversion, winding or deformation, and can adsorb more microorganisms or impurities, thereby not only promoting the propagation of fish, but also purifying the water body and beautifying the water body environment.
Specifically, referring to fig. 3, the upper ends of the unit box bodies 10 are provided with handles 11, and the peripheries of the lower ends of the unit box bodies 10 are provided with protective nets.
In this embodiment: the upper end of the unit box body 10 is provided with the handle 11, the fish nest inserting frame 3 is convenient to take, the lower end of the unit box body 10 is provided with the protective net all around, and the anti-pulling capacity of the protective net is high through arrangement, so that damage and damage can be reduced.
The working principle and the using process of the utility model are as follows: when in use, a plurality of artificial fish nest monomers 7 are mutually hung and arranged on the water surface as required, prepared aquatic weeds are laid on a bank, a plurality of fish nest inserting frames 3 are respectively taken down and two L-shaped frames 302 are pulled one by one in opposite directions to expand meshes of the aquatic weed hanging net 303, the aquatic weed hanging net 303 is attached to the laid aquatic weeds one by one and tightened, partial aquatic weeds can be clamped in the meshes of the aquatic weed hanging net 303, then the fish nest inserting frames 3 are respectively inserted and clamped back into the slots 201 of the flat plate 2, cultured fishes can lay fish eggs on the aquatic weeds on the aquatic weed hanging net 303 when laying eggs, when the fish eggs need to be taken out, the fish nest inserting frames 3 can be pulled out, one end of the water floating plates 1 of the artificial fish nest monomers 7 which can be laid into a passageway adhesion matrix 8 for people to walk is provided with a floater 6, the artificial fish nests are kept to float vertically in the water body, and are prevented from being inverted, wound or deformed, can adsorb more microorganisms or impurities, promote fish reproduction, purify water body, and beautify water body environment.
